操作系统期末试题及复习资料.docx
《操作系统期末试题及复习资料.docx》由会员分享,可在线阅读,更多相关《操作系统期末试题及复习资料.docx(10页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、(答案在后面)得 分评分人一、 填空题(每空1分,共10分)1. 常见的控制方式有程序方式、 中断 控制方式、 控制方式和 通道 控制方式四种。2. 操作系统向用户提供的两个基本接口是 程序 接口和 用户 接口。3. 若在一分页存储管理系统中,某作业的页表如下所示。已知页面大小为1024字节,逻辑地址(3082)10转化得到的物理地址是 6154 。页号块号021321364. 具有多路性、独立性、及时性和交互性特征的操作系统是 分时 操作系统。5. 通道用于控制 设备控制器 及内存之间的信息交换。6. 事务的最基本特性是 。7. 若盘块大小为4,每个盘块号占4字节,在采用两级索引时允许的最大
2、文件长度为 4 。得 分评分人二、 单选题(每题2分,共20分)1. 用磁带作为文件存贮介质时,文件只能组织成( )。A. 顺序文件 B. 链接文件 C. 索引文件 D. 目录文件2. 一作业8:00到达系统,估计运行时间为1小时,若10:00开始执行该作业,则其响应比是(C)。A. 2 B. 1 C. 3 D. 0.53. 文件系统采用多级目录结构后,对于不同用户的文件,其文件名( C )。A. 应该相同 B. 应该不同 C. 可以相同,也可以不同 D. 受系统约束4. 死锁预防是保证系统不进入死锁状态的静态策略,其解决方法是破坏产生死锁的四个必要条件之一。下列方法中破坏了“循环等待”条件的
3、是( D )。 A. 银行家算法 B. 一次性分配策略 C. 剥夺资源法 D. 资源有序分配法5. 进程状态从就绪态到运行态的转化工作是由( B )完成的。A. 作业调度 B. 进程调度 C. 页面调度 D. 设备调度6. 采用缓冲技术的主要目的是( C )。A. 改善用户编程环境 B. 提高的处理速度 C. 提高和设备间的并行程度 D. 实现及设备无关性7. 目录文件所存放的信息是( D )。A. 该目录中所有数据文件目录 B. 某一文件存放的数据信息 C. 某一个文件的文件目录 D. 该目录中所有文件的目录8. 最容易形成很多小碎片的可变分区分配算法是( D )。A. 首次适应算法 B.
4、循环首次适应算法C. 最坏适应算法 D. 最佳适应算法9. 用户程序及实际使用的物理设备无关是由( A )功能实现的。A. 设备独立性 B. 设备驱动 C. 虚拟设备 D. 设备分配10. 下面关于顺序文件、链接文件和索引文件的论述中不正确的是( A )。A. 显示链接文件是在每个盘块中设置一个链接指针,用于将该文件所属的所有盘块链接起来 B. 顺序文件必须采用连续分配方式,而链接文件和索引文件则都可采取离散分配方式C. 顺序文件适用于对诸记录进行批量存取时 D. 在交互应用场合,需要经常查找访问单个记录时,更适合用顺序或索引文件得 分评分人三、 简答题。(每题4分,共20分)1. 文件系统对
5、目录管理的主要要求是什么? 实现“按名存取” (1分) 提高对目录的检索速度 (1分) 文件共享 (1分) 允许文件重名 (1分)2. 什么是技术,系统由哪几部分组成?技术是一种虚拟设备技术,它可以把一台独占设备改造成为虚拟设备,在进程所需的物理设备不存在或被占用的情况下,使用该设备。技术是对脱机输入,输出系统的模拟,又称为假脱机操作。(2分)系统主要由三部分组成:输入井和输出井、输入缓冲区和输出缓冲区、输入进程和输出进程。(2分)3. 文件分配表的作用及类别。4. 某系统中有4个并发进程,都需要同类资源5个,假设现在用信号量S代表该资源,当前S的值为-2。请回答: 保证该系统不会发生死锁的最
6、少资源数是几个?17个 假设信号量S的初值等于第问中的结果,那么系统中的相关进程至少执行了几次P(S)操作?19次 及信号量S相关的处于阻塞状态的进程有几个?两个 要使信号量S的值大于0,应该进行怎样的操作? V(S)操作释放信号量的次数至少要比P(S)操作多3次。5. 试分别从以下方面对进程和线程进行比较: 地址空间:线程是进程内的一个执行单元,进程至少拥有一个线程,同属一个进程的多个线程共享该进程的地址空间;而进程则有自己独立的地址空间。 资源拥有:资源拥有:进程是资源分配和拥有的基本单位,同一个进程所属的多个线程共享进程所有的资源。 处理机调度:线程是处理机调度的基本单位 能否并发执行:
7、进程和线程均可以并发执行得 分评分人四、 应用题(每题10分,共30分)1. 某请求分页式存储管理系统,接收一个共7页的作业。作业运行时的页面走向如下:1、5、2、1、3、2、4、7、2、4。假定系统为该作业分配了3块内存空间,内存页块初始均为空,假设算法以队列,算法以堆栈作为辅助结构,请填表并计算: 采用先进先出()页面淘汰算法时,会产生多少次缺页中断?缺页率是多少?页面走向1521324724队列是否缺页换出页 缺页中断次数为: 缺页率为: 采用最近最久未用()页面淘汰算法时,会产生多少次缺页中断?缺页率是多少?页面走向1521324724堆栈是否缺页换出页 缺页中断次数为: 缺页率为:
8、2假定磁盘的移动臂现在处于第10柱面,由内向外运动(磁道号由小到大)。现有一组磁盘请求以60、8、15、4、20、40柱面的次序到达磁盘驱动器,移动臂移动一个柱面需要6,请完成下面的问题: 访问磁盘所需的时间由哪三部分构成? 若采用先来先服务算法进行磁盘调度,请给出柱面访问序列,计算平均寻道时间。 若采用最短寻找时间优先算法进行磁盘调度,请给出柱面访问序列,计算平均寻道时间。 若采用电梯扫描算法进行磁盘调度,请给出柱面访问序列,计算平均寻道时间。3系统中有4类资源(A,B,C,D)和5个进程P0P4,T0时刻的系统状态如下表所示,系统采用银行家算法实施死锁避免策略。P01,2,3,40,0,1
9、,21,2,2,3P11,0,0,01,7,5,0P20,2,1,02,3,5,6P30,2,1,00,6,5,8P41,0,1,10,6,5,7请回答: 系统中的4类资源总量分别是多少?4 8 8 8 T0状态是否安全?为什么?T0时刻存在一个安全序列P0,P2,P4,P3,P1,故系统是安全的。 在T0状态的基础上,若进程P2提出请求(1,1,0,1),系统能否将资源分配给它?请说明理由。进程P2提出请求(1,1,0,1)后,因且,故系统可考虑将资源分配给它,分配后,将变为(0,1,2,2),进行安全性检测,发现存在一个安全序列P0,P2,P4,P3,P1,故系统是安全的。 在T0状态的基
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 操作系统 期末 试题 复习资料
限制150内